Transaction 86a2cfd8199ab679c7aa5bb549540077234ecf7d4b551b99e79c535de4bc33bc

2 Input
2 Outputs
  • 86a2cfd8199ab679c7aa5bb549540077234ecf7d4b551b99e79c535de4bc33bc:0
  • value  16796245
    address  34CyV8iWBUfikj3poK4UKqRbckCE44ofSd
  • 86a2cfd8199ab679c7aa5bb549540077234ecf7d4b551b99e79c535de4bc33bc:1
  • value  2000000
    address  1CGHYRB6exfYgP1vUggXWEiSrz2x8K3741